The golden age is ahead, not behind us: one day Jesus will return and set everything right. But in Matthew 24, Jesus foretells that before His return there will be a period of worldwide distress called "the tribulation." God will use this span of seven years to pave the way for Christ's return and to fulfill His promises to the Jewish people, who the Bible predicts will receive their Messiah at last.

Scripture passages cited (or alluded to) in this message include Ezekiel 36:24, 34-35; John 1:11; Romans 11:26, 28; Matthew 23:37-24:35; Daniel 9:24-27; Nehemiah 2:5-6; Luke 19:42; 21:5-36; 2 Thessalonians 2:1-8; Revelation 12:14; 13:1-18; and Zechariah 12:10; 13:1-2.
